Patents by Inventor Rebecca Greenberg

Rebecca Greenberg has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230147633
    Abstract: Systems and methods for configuring an email engine associated with sequences of engagements are described. The email engine is associated with a first sequence of engagements and a second sequence of engagements. The email engine is configured to be activated based on completion of the first sequence of engagements. The email engine may be configured to generate and send an email to an email recipient based on a set of parameters unique to the email recipient and based on one or more government regulations. When the sending of the email is prevented because of the set of parameters or the government regulations, an error notification may be generated, and the second sequence of engagements may not be activated.
    Type: Application
    Filed: October 25, 2022
    Publication date: May 11, 2023
    Inventors: Rebecca Greenberg, David Louie, Mattia Padovani, Darpan Dhamija
  • Patent number: 11539652
    Abstract: Systems and methods for processing email messages are described. A method may include obtaining, from a database associated with the database system, data identifying a plurality of email messages for a plurality of email senders, the email messages associated with one or more sales cadences and an email service; enqueuing, by the server computing system, data identifying one or more email messages of the plurality of email messages into a queue provided that no data identifying two email messages associated with a first email sender are in the queue concurrently; and dequeuing, by the server computing system, the data identifying the one or more email messages from the queue, each dequeued data identifying an email message to be processed by the email service, wherein said enqueuing is performed provided that no dequeued data identifying two email messages associated with a second email sender are concurrently waiting to be processed by the email service.
    Type: Grant
    Filed: July 23, 2020
    Date of Patent: December 27, 2022
    Assignee: Salesforce, Inc.
    Inventors: Rebecca Greenberg, Mattia Padovani
  • Patent number: 11509608
    Abstract: Systems and methods for configuring an email engine associated with sequences of engagements are described. The email engine is associated with a first sequence of engagements and a second sequence of engagements. The email engine is configured to be activated based on completion of the first sequence of engagements. The email engine may be configured to generate and send an email to an email recipient based on a set of parameters unique to the email recipient and based on one or more government regulations. When the sending of the email is prevented because of the set of parameters or the government regulations, an error notification may be generated, and the second sequence of engagements may not be activated.
    Type: Grant
    Filed: April 13, 2020
    Date of Patent: November 22, 2022
    Assignee: Salesforce, Inc.
    Inventors: Rebecca Greenberg, David Louie, Mattia Padovani, Darpan Dhamija
  • Publication number: 20210320888
    Abstract: Systems and methods for configuring an email engine associated with sequences of engagements are described. The email engine is associated with a first sequence of engagements and a second sequence of engagements. The email engine is configured to be activated based on completion of the first sequence of engagements. The email engine may be configured to generate and send an email to an email recipient based on a set of parameters unique to the email recipient and based on one or more government regulations. When the sending of the email is prevented because of the set of parameters or the government regulations, an error notification may be generated, and the second sequence of engagements may not be activated.
    Type: Application
    Filed: April 13, 2020
    Publication date: October 14, 2021
    Inventors: Rebecca Greenberg, David Louie, Mattia Padovani, Darpan Dhamija
  • Publication number: 20210320892
    Abstract: Systems and methods for processing email messages are described. A method may include obtaining, from a database associated with the database system, data identifying a plurality of email messages for a plurality of email senders, the email messages associated with one or more sales cadences and an email service; enqueuing, by the server computing system, data identifying one or more email messages of the plurality of email messages into a queue provided that no data identifying two email messages associated with a first email sender are in the queue concurrently; and dequeuing, by the server computing system, the data identifying the one or more email messages from the queue, each dequeued data identifying an email message to be processed by the email service, wherein said enqueuing is performed provided that no dequeued data identifying two email messages associated with a second email sender are concurrently waiting to be processed by the email service.
    Type: Application
    Filed: July 23, 2020
    Publication date: October 14, 2021
    Inventors: Rebecca Greenberg, Mattia Padovani
  • Patent number: 10681499
    Abstract: A method for creating a dynamic entity location map, includes sending an electronic communication to a first entity, obtaining, when the electronic communication is opened, notification data, calculating a location at which the electronic communication was opened based on the notification data, storing, in a database, a record that contains an association of the location and the first entity, wherein the database stores a plurality of records of entities with associated location data, and generating a map interface that displays a geographical region and displays an icon for the first entity, the icon being displayed at a position within the geographical region based on the location associated with the first entity.
    Type: Grant
    Filed: July 31, 2018
    Date of Patent: June 9, 2020
    Assignee: SALESFORCE.COM, INC.
    Inventors: Mattia Padovani, Rebecca Greenberg
  • Publication number: 20200045506
    Abstract: A method for creating a dynamic entity location map, includes sending an electronic communication to a first entity, obtaining, when the electronic communication is opened, notification data, calculating a location at which the electronic communication was opened based on the notification data, storing, in a database, a record that contains an association of the location and the first entity, wherein the database stores a plurality of records of entities with associated location data, and generating a map interface that displays a geographical region and displays an icon for the first entity, the icon being displayed at a position within the geographical region based on the location associated with the first entity.
    Type: Application
    Filed: July 31, 2018
    Publication date: February 6, 2020
    Inventors: Mattia Padovani, Rebecca Greenberg